My Vauxhall vextra 2002 has just had a new head gasket but the car is still overheating. It quickly goes to 90-100 degrees whilst driving and the warning light comes on. I have to fill the water up every morning as its empty and now the engine management light has come on! Its also had a new thermostat!
Alsio the heating has stopped working!!

it sounds like you have an air lock in the system try filling the rad trough the top hose first then run with the heaters on full hot topping up the water gradually through header tank plus you need to get the codes read as well
